Edgar Franzmann (born September 21, 1948 in Krefeld ) is a German writer and journalist .

Life

After graduating from high school, Franzmann studied German , philosophy and sociology at the University of Cologne . During his studies he began his journalistic activity in 1968 - initially as a freelancer for the NRZ and the Kölner Express , where he received his first editor's contract in 1971 and worked in the local and sports departments.

In the middle of 1973 Franzmann became editor of the Sonntag-Express, whose editorial management he took over at the end of the 1970s. From 1989 to 1995 he was head of the culture department there. In 1996 he switched to DuMont Neue Medien and became the founder and editor-in-chief of the online editions of Express, Kölner Stadt-Anzeiger and Kölnische Rundschau . From the beginning of 2000 until reaching the age limit at the end of November 2013, Franzmann was editor-in-chief of the internet portal koeln.de , which is published by NetCologne on behalf of the city of Cologne.

After some experience as a non-fiction author, Franzmann began writing fiction in 2005 . In 2009, his first crime novel, Mio Allee, appeared as a Cologne crime thriller . Franzmann's novels are set in a journalistic environment. His hero Georg Rubin is the chief reporter for the fictional tabloid "Blitz".

Franzmann is a member of the Syndikat , the association of German-speaking crime authors. From April 2012 to May 2014 he was managing spokesman for the syndicate. He is co-founder of the Cologne crime festival Crime Cologne.
